NCP694D33HT1G Overview
The NCP694 is a CMOS technology-based integrated circuit with a base part number of NCP694. It has a total of 5 pins and a maximum power dissipation of 900mW. The maximum input voltage for this IC is 6V, and it has a positive output configuration. The quiescent current is 100μA, and the dropout voltage is 180mV. The length of the IC is 4.6mm, and it is not radiation hardened.
